when I first started my counselling sessions I was feeling really low. I was recommended to start counselling by the Seamoor Unit.

Speaking with Sophie has encouraged me to look at parts of my life that I had boxed away. Having faced these thoughts I am trying to move forward from them, which in the main has worked. 

having been isolated with lockdown just after my diagnosis there were times when I felt as if I was in a wilderness. Sophie has assisted me in dealing with this and has given me suggestions on how to deal with these matters. 

My sessions with Sophie have now concluded and at times I almost feel panic that these sessions have come o an end. Especially with lock down again. 

Sophie has suggested the next time I speak with someone from the Hospice I ask for what assistance they may be able to provide in joining me with some classes they may be running. 

I am very grateful to the assistance and help I have received through the counselling sessions.
